Solar water heater replacement services involve removing an existing solar water heating system and installing a new unit to ensure continued efficient hot water supply. The process typically includes evaluating the current system’s condition, removing outdated or malfunctioning components, and installing a modern solar water heater that meets the property’s hot water needs. Professionals handle the necessary connections to existing plumbing and electrical systems, ensuring that the new system operates properly and safely. This service aims to provide a reliable hot water source while optimizing the performance of the solar heating setup.
Replacing a solar water heater helps address issues such as reduced efficiency, frequent breakdowns, or outdated technology that no longer meets household demands. Over time, solar collectors and storage tanks can suffer from wear and tear, leading to decreased energy output and higher utility bills. A replacement can restore the system’s effectiveness, ensuring consistent hot water availability. Additionally, upgrading to a newer model can improve energy savings and reduce maintenance requirements, making it a practical solution for property owners experiencing issues with their current solar water heating systems.

Replacement Costs - The typical expense for solar water heater replacement services ranges from $3,000 to $8,000, depending on the system size and type. For example, a standard residential system might cost around $4,500. Costs can vary based on local labor and material prices.
Material Expenses - The price of new solar water heaters generally falls between $2,000 and $6,000. High-efficiency or larger capacity units tend to be at the higher end of this range.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ific system requirements.
Installation Fees - Installation costs typically range from $1,000 to $3,000, influenced by the complexity of the setup and existing plumbing. Some installations may require additional work, which could affect the overall price.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ses, such as permits or system upgrades, may add $200 to $1,000 to the total. These costs vary depending on local regulations and the condition of existing infrastructure.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should a solar water heater be replaced? The replacement timeline for a solar water heater varies based on usage, maintenance, and system quality. Consulting with local service providers can help determine when replacement is appropriate.
What are signs that a solar water heater needs replacement? Indicators include reduced hot water output, leaks, corrosion, or frequent system failures. A professional assessment can identify if replacement is necessary.
Can a solar water heater be upgraded instead of replaced? Upgrading components or adding new panels may improve performance, but in some cases, replacing the entire system offers better long-term value. A local contractor can advise on options.
What factors influence the cost of replacing a solar water heater? Costs depend on system size, type, and installation complexity. Getting quotes from local service providers can provide a clearer understanding of potential expenses.
How long does a typical solar water heater replacement take? The duration varies based on system size and site conditions, but most replacements are completed within a day by experienced local contractors.
